Default upgrading wifes detector need help

I am thinking of selling my Prism V and getting either a silver Umax or Cibola or a Garrett 250 or 350. My wife uses the prism so it needs to be light and somewhat simple. I figure I can get $300-$350 for my Prisum V so thats my budget. Any advice or other suggestions is greatly appreciated. I should add that she will use it almost always on the beaches of Florida. If you want easy and light weight then Tesoro is the way to go. I have the Tesoro Silver uMax and LOVE it. Only 2.2 pounds, uses 1 9 volt battery, and can find a dime at 9 inches. Good Luck with whatever you choose. : )
